Jeffery Joseph Chianello, 58, of Noblesville, died Sept. 4, 2014 at his residence. Born Oct. 10, 1955 in Angola, he was the son of Sam and Doris (Hodnicky) Chianello.

He was a technical sales representative for Houghton International. He was an active member of Our Lady of Grace Catholic Church in Noblesville. He received his education in chemistry and biology from Youngstown State University, where he also played football. Through the years, he consistently participated in the activities of his children as a coach, teacher and mentor. He was an avid Indianapolis Colts and Cleveland Indians fan; an enthusiastic cook; and a dedicated family man.

Survivors include his wife of 37 years, Leona (Carrier) Chianello; children, Dana (Brent) Phillips, Jeffery Joseph (Courtney) Chianello II and Zachary (Molly) Chianello; mother; siblings, Karen (Joe) Fasulo, Lorraine (Scott) Simka and Sammy (Cheryl) Chianello; grandchildren, Francis, Jeffery Joseph III and Veronica; five Godchildren; 12 nieces and nephews; and six great-nieces and nephews. He was preceded in death by his father.

Funeral services were held Sept. 8 at Our Lady of Grace Catholic Church, 9900 E. 191st St., Noblesville with the Rev. Tom Metzger officiating.
